STIR-FRIED PORK WITH GREEN PEPPERS

Ingredients

Quantities are shown as originally provided.

  • 8 oz lean boneless pork loin ((feel free to substitute with other type of meats you like))
  • 1 Chinese sausage ((remove the casing and cut into thin slices))
  • 1 large green bell pepper ((cut into half, take out the seeds and cut into strips))
  • 2 garlic cloves ((finely minced))
  • 2 tsp fermented black beans
  • 1 tsp corn starch mixed with 1 tsp of water
  • About 3 Tbsp peanut oil
  • Salt to taste
  • 2 tsp shaoxing wine
  • 1 tsp light soy sauce
  • 1 tsp dark soy sauce

Instructions

  1. 1

    Cut the the lean pork into thin slices; set aside the pork belly. Add the marinades and let it sit for at least 30 minutes

  2. 2

    Preheat your wok until reall hot, add about 1/2 Tbsp of oil and add in the pepper and stir-fry until really fragrant, about 3 minute or so. Remove from the wok and set aside

  3. 3

    Reheat the wok over a hot flame until smoke rises, then add 2 Tbsp of the oil and swirl to make sure the oil is evenly spread. Add in the sausage slices and stir-fry for about 10 seconds, Add in garlic and black bean and stir-fry for about 8 seconds, add in the pork slices and stir-fry until the pork is cooked through. Add the bell peppers back into the wok and stir-fry for about 1 minute

  4. 4

    Give the corn-starch mixture a stir and pour into the work. Stir everything and the sauce will thicken almost immediately. Turn off the heat and serve immediately with rice as part of multi-course meal
